Split linked A/B switch apparatus
First Claim
1. A switch apparatus, comprising:
- a first input port including a first switch for switching between a first position to input a first set of primary. channels and a second position to connect to a termination;
a second input port including a second switch for switching between a first position to input a second set of primary channels and a second position to input a set of secondary channels, the set of secondary channels including the sum of the first and second sets of primary channels;
a controller for controlling the first switch and the second switch, wherein when the controller detects a predetermined condition, the controller switches the first and second switches simultaneously from the first positions to the second positions, and when the controller detects that the predetermined condition is over, the controller switches the first and second switches simultaneously from the second positions to the first positions; and
an output port including a combiner for outputting combined first and second sets of primary channels when the first and second switches are switched to the first positions, and for outputting the set of secondary channels when the first and second switches are switched to the second positions.

Abstract
A switch apparatus is used in the transmission of a redundant Cable TV (CTV) signal. The redundant CTV signal can be a symmetric split linked redundant CTV signal or an asymmetric split linked redundant CTV signal. The switch apparatus is capable of handling both the symmetric and asymmetric redundant CTV signal where primary channels are split into multiple parts. The asymmetrical splitting of the primary channels is where one part contains more channels than another part. The switch apparatus includes a plurality of switches and a monitor device to detect a failure in the split signal path before the split signals are combined to be transmitted to downstream end-users. Upon detecting a failure, the switches are switched from primary channels to secondary channels by a controller. After the signal is returned, the switches are switched back to the primary channels. A delay timer may be included in the switch apparatus to avoid incidental or temporary signal recovery.
